As a result of progress, technology and automation, the world of work is changing and will continue to change.  For many, it is a scary prospect to hear that “40% of current Australian jobs have a moderate to high likelihood of disappearing in the next 10 to 15 years” (CEDA).  The simple fact is that we can no longer think of career planning as a one-off process leading to a “job for life”.  We need to walk our own path while remaining flexible and open to new experiences.
